All Five-Letter Words Starting With O
Below is a curated collection of valid 5-letter words starting with O, sourced from widely accepted Wordle-compatible word lists. These words span everyday vocabulary, science terms, and classic English — all fair game in a standard Wordle game.
OCCUR, OCEAN, OFFER, OFTEN, OLIVE, ONSET, OPERA, OPTIC, ORBIT, ORDER, OTHER, OTTER, OUGHT, OUTDO, OUTER, OVARY, OVOID, OWING, OXIDE, OZONE, OAKEN, OBESE, ODDER, OFFAL, OPINE, ORATE, ORGAN

Subgroups of Five-Letter O Words
Breaking five-letter words starting with O into subgroups by their first two letters is one of the smartest Wordle strategies. When you know the second letter, you can immediately narrow your search to a much smaller pool.
OB- Words
The OB- subgroup is small but useful. OBESE is the standout here — a common English word that Wordle setters love for its mix of vowels (O, E) and less-common letters. If your second guess reveals a B in position two, pivot straight to this cluster.
OC- Words
OC- words include two Wordle favorites: OCCUR and OCEAN. OCEAN is particularly valuable because it contains four distinct vowels (O, E, A) in just five letters, making it an excellent early guess for mapping vowel positions across the board.
OR- Words
The OR- subgroup is the richest of the four, featuring ORBIT, ORDER, ORGAN, and ORATE. These words cover a wide range of common consonants (B, D, G, T) alongside the OR- opening, giving you excellent letter-coverage when you need to eliminate options quickly.
OT- Words
OT- words — OTTER and OTHER — are both high-frequency English words that appear regularly in Wordle. OTHER is especially useful as a guess because it includes T, H, E, and R, four of the most common letters in the English language.

Tips for Guessing Five-Letter Words Starting With O
Using O words for Wordle effectively takes more than a list — it takes strategy. Here are six practical tips to sharpen your approach.
- Use O as a vowel anchor. O in position one is a strong anchor. Pair it with high-frequency consonants (R, T, N, S) in your follow-up guesses to eliminate large chunks of the alphabet fast.
- Prioritize vowel-rich O words early. Words like OCEAN (four vowels) and OLIVE (three vowels) are excellent second guesses when your opener reveals an O. They map multiple vowel positions in a single guess.
- Lean on the OR- subgroup. OR- words are the most numerous among 5-letter words starting with O. If you confirm O and R early, focus your remaining guesses on ORBIT, ORDER, ORGAN, and ORATE before branching out.
- Watch for double letters. OTTER and OZONE both contain repeated letters. If your guesses keep missing and common letters are eliminated, consider that the answer might repeat a letter — a classic Wordle curveball.
- Eliminate by second letter. Once you know the word starts with O, your next priority is the second letter. A single guess that tests B, C, R, and T in position two (e.g., a word containing all four) can instantly identify the subgroup.
- Keep a mental shortlist. Memorize the most common five-letter words starting with O — OCEAN, ORBIT, OLIVE, OTHER, OUTER, OZONE — so you can recall them instantly under the six-guess pressure of a live Wordle game.
